The page http://wiki.gnokii.org/index.php/Security_options says

    if you own a Nokia and "Model" prints a code similar to RM-146 instead of 
the commercial
    name of the phone please report this issue to the gnokii mailing list or to 
the bug tracker
    of your distribution showing the version of gnokii, the output of gnokii 
--identify (the IMEI
    is not needed), the name of the phone as printed on the box and a link to 
phone page at
    http://www.forum.nokia.com/devices/

$ gnokii --identify
GNOKII Version 0.6.27
IMEI         : XXXXXXXXXXXXXX
Manufacturer : Nokia
Model        : RM-260
Product name : RM-260
Revision     : V 26.00

Nokia device page: http://www.forum.nokia.com/devices/6085/

Don't have the box, no name available.

FYI, I can get much done with this phone with

[global]
model = 6510

in my .gnokiirc. Much includes SMS, reading calendar and contacts, etc.
Haven't tried writing calendar/contacts yet.
